Buying Guide

  • Power needs: For large gatherings, consider higher wattage units like the Rock Party 9 for room-filling bass and clear highs. For cozy spaces, smaller options such as iHome or Alpine sets may suffice.
  • Power source: Choose between battery-powered, solar-powered, or mains-powered options based on your event duration and location. Solar models are ideal for sun-soaked yards but may require backup charging in low sunlight.
  • Water resistance: If you expect rain or mist, prioritize IPX5 or IPX7-rated models to minimize weather-related issues.
  • Wireless features: Look for Bluetooth versions with longer range (5.x) and support for true wireless stereo (TWS) if you want multi-speaker setups for around-the-yard coverage.
  • Special features: Karaoke inputs, LED light shows, USB playback, and app control can add value, depending on your intended use and event style.

FAQ

  1. What makes a rock speaker suitable for outdoors?

    Look for weather resistance, rugged casings, and long battery life or reliable power. Solar charging helps sessions across sunny days.

  2. Are solar-powered rock speakers enough for night use?

    Some models provide extended playtime after sunset, but battery capacity and sun exposure impact performance at night.

  3. Can I pair two rock speakers for wider coverage?

    Many models support dual speakers or TWS connections for stereo sound across a larger area. Check the product’s pairing capabilities.

  4. Which features should I prioritize for karaoke or live performances?

    Look for built-in mics, guitar inputs, auto-tune, and a strong bass response to handle vocal and instrumental dynamics.

  5. Is IP rating critical for backyard use?

    Yes. IPX5 or IPX7 ratings protect against splashes and rain, ensuring durability during outdoor gatherings.
